Abstract :
Two Quadrature Single Side Band Mixers based on Gilbert-Cell are designed for multi-band OFDM (Orthogonal Frequency Division Multilplexing) Ultra Wide Band(UWB) applications. The sideband suppression is about -56 dBc for 3.432 GHz and -48 dBc for 3.96 GHz Hz and -43 dBc for 4.488 GHz in the upper QSSB Mixer while -50 dBc for 792 MHz in the lower QSSB with 16 mA from a 1.8 V power supply, utilizing JAZZ 0.18 mum CMOS RF process. The performance of the QSSB Mixers meets the requirement of the system specifications. The QSSB Mixers are under-test.
